Jamaica, Railroad station in Jamaica, Queens, New York, US

Jamaica Station is a railroad facility in Queens with six island platforms and ten tracks that serve Long Island Rail Road operations. The building connects multiple transit systems and provides access to different modes of transportation through its main hall and concourse areas.

The current building was constructed between 1912 and 1913 and replaced two earlier stations that previously operated at this location. This reconstruction happened to better serve the growing transportation demands of the region.

The station building displays classical architecture from the early 1900s with symmetrical facades and large windows that fill the interior with light. These design choices reflect how Americans built important transportation hubs during that era.

The interior gets crowded during rush hours, so arriving early and allowing extra time is wise for travelers. Signage and staff members throughout the facility help you find the right exit and platform areas.

The station connects Long Island Rail Road service to the AirTrain line heading to JFK Airport, making it a gateway for air travelers. This connection point allows people to transfer seamlessly between rail and airport transport.
